Market Overview and Growth Drivers

The Morocco percutaneous transluminal coronary angioplasty (PTCA) catheter market is experiencing a period of significant growth driven by the rising prevalence of cardiovascular diseases (CVD) and increasing healthcare access across the country. Cardiovascular diseases, especially coronary artery disease (CAD), are one of the leading causes of morbidity and mortality in Morocco, largely attributed to lifestyle factors such as poor diet, physical inactivity, and an aging population. As the demand for advanced treatment options grows, PTCA procedures—used to treat blocked coronary arteries—have become an essential part of cardiac care.

Morocco’s healthcare sector has been undergoing continuous improvement, particularly in urban regions where specialized cardiac care is becoming more accessible. The government has been actively investing in healthcare infrastructure and improving access to modern medical technologies. These efforts, combined with the growing awareness of cardiovascular health, have led to a higher adoption of minimally invasive procedures such as PTCA, further driving the demand for PTCA catheters. As healthcare becomes more advanced and accessible, the PTCA catheter market in Morocco is expected to see robust growth in the coming years, offering new opportunities for manufacturers and suppliers.

Key Drivers of Market Growth

Several key factors are driving the growth of the PTCA catheter market in Morocco. One of the primary drivers is the increasing incidence of coronary artery disease, compounded by the rising rates of hypertension, diabetes, obesity, and smoking. These risk factors are contributing to a growing number of patients requiring coronary interventions, thus driving demand for PTCA procedures. The aging population in Morocco is another significant contributor to the increased need for coronary care, as older individuals are more susceptible to developing heart disease.

Furthermore, the growing preference for minimally invasive techniques over traditional open-heart surgeries is another key factor driving market expansion. PTCA procedures, which involve the use of catheters to open blocked arteries and restore blood flow to the heart, offer significant advantages such as shorter recovery times, fewer complications, and reduced healthcare costs. As these procedures continue to be preferred by both patients and healthcare providers, the demand for PTCA catheters is expected to rise. Additionally, Morocco’s improving healthcare policies, which focus on expanding access to advanced treatments and technologies, will continue to support the market’s growth.

Emerging Trends and Technological Advancements

The PTCA catheter market in Morocco is evolving with several key technological advancements and trends that are shaping its growth. One significant trend is the increasing use of drug-eluting balloon (DEB) catheters, which are designed to release medication during the procedure to prevent restenosis, or the re-narrowing of treated arteries. These advanced catheters have become a critical part of the treatment for coronary artery disease, offering improved outcomes for patients and reducing the need for repeat procedures.

Another major trend is the integration of advanced imaging technologies, such as optical coherence tomography (OCT) and intravascular ultrasound (IVUS), into PTCA procedures. These imaging systems allow cardiologists to obtain high-resolution images of the coronary arteries, helping them to more accurately place catheters and improve the success rate of procedures. As healthcare providers in Morocco increasingly adopt these technologies, the demand for PTCA catheters that are compatible with OCT and IVUS systems is expected to grow. Furthermore, the introduction of bioresorbable stents and next-generation catheter designs that offer better flexibility, precision, and biocompatibility is driving innovation in the market, creating new opportunities for manufacturers.
